Circa 1900, top quality American oak roll top desk/bureau sold by ‘Stewart & Co, Glasgow’. The solid rectangular top has a moulded edge and a presentation plaque, and beneath this is an ‘S’ shaped slatted shutter with a stylish escutcheon with the retailers name and a double sided lock. When the shutter is open it reveals a well organised interior of almost 30 various sized drawers and pigeon holes and a large writing surface. There are 2 open apertures cut into the sides, which would have been for internal posting when the desk was locked. Below the top is a configuration of one long drawer in the centre and pull out slides over 4 graduating drawers on each side. The handles are carved oak and ribbed in an almost gadroon pattern. When the flap is closed this has a mechanism which locks the drawers. The sides of the desk have fielded panels, and the back is polished making it a freestanding piece. There is a fielded panel section at the back of the kneehole (known as a courtesy board). All standing on an enclosed plinth. Very good example of an American rolltop desk.

Georgian Antiques was founded in 1978 by John Dixon's brother Padriac in a small shop at Jocks Lodge, Meadowbank in Edinburgh, with John joining the business after finishing college in 1981. The business grew so rapidly, they couldn't keep up with their inventory needs. Their goal has been to create a one-stop-shop where designers can complete an entire project from antique lighting to antique furniture to accessories. Scotland's largest antiques warehouse is located in a converted whiskey bond in historic Leith Edinburgh. With 50,000sq ft over five floors we offer a wide range of quality Georgian, Victorian and Edwardian furniture, as well as continental and small decorative items. Our stock is constantly changing.
